Mercury poisoning is the result of being exposed to too much mercury. People can get mercury poisoning from eating seafood, industrial processing, or even from dental work such as a dental filling. How to test for mercury poisoning from fillings may need assistance from a health professional. Also, mercury poisoning from old fillings can affect your eye health.
